Transaction 26805a6ea1603955db118dacce665978e9715523c97efa344f3f6d09cd716c7a
1 Input
1 Output
-
26805a6ea1603955db118dacce665978e9715523c97efa344f3f6d09cd716c7a:0
- value
- 2004308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 227afbc4d7010c52c7ded8130653599feba9166a OP_EQUAL
- address
- 34qLE7BhuooNP9gYRQMGNePyEubN8Xkkoo